Abstract: A method of reducing error caused by rotational movement during position sensing in a system comprising a magnetic rod attached to a movable object, two or more linear position sensors positioned substantially equidistant to each other on a radius around the magnetic rod attached to the movable object, and electronics is disclosed. The method includes measuring magnetized lines of flux being radiated from the magnetic rod attached to the movable object, the linear position sensors translating respective sensed lines of flux into corresponding voltage and using the electronics to sum the corresponding signals i.e., voltages, and determine the average of the corresponding signals, i.e., voltages.

Abstract: A capacitive discharge ignition system for an internal combustion engine and for use with a generator powered current source comprises a storage capacitor, at least one power thyristor for discharging the storage capacitor to transfer energy to at least one coil triggered in synchronism with an internal combustion engine with which the ignition system may be associated. A triggering circuit biases the power thyristor to discharge the storage capacitor. A shut-off circuit comprises a solid state device for switching the output of the generator to ground interrupting the flow of current to the power thyristor. A circuit sensing current flow in the triggering circuit generates a control and gates the solid state device into conduction in response to the control signal.
